Daniel M. McVay Sept. 27, 2012 Daniel M. McVay, 96, of Sedona, died Sept. 27. Born in Nebraska, he was an engineer and cartographer, and served as the director of a nationwide program for accurately measuring and recording the boundaries of public lands managed by the U. S. Forest Service. He is survived by daughter Janet McVay; son Gerald McVay; granddaughter Susannah Ries; grandson Collin McVay; and four great-grandchildren. A memorial service takes place at 2 p.m. Wednesday, Oct. 3, at the Bueler Funeral Home in Camp Verde. |
